下一代Lua驱动终极编辑器,内置LSP,编码丝滑体验

下一代Lua驱动终极编辑器,内置LSP,编码丝滑体验

白诚轩 2025-02-28 明星八卦 541 次浏览 0个评论
摘要:,,下一代终极编辑器是一款强大的编程工具,采用Lua驱动,具备内置LSP功能,为用户带来前所未有的编码体验。这款编辑器旨在让编程过程如丝般顺滑,助力开发者高效完成代码编写和调试工作。,,该编辑器采用Lua作为驱动语言,Lua作为一种轻量级、高效的脚本语言,为编辑器提供了强大的扩展性和灵活性。开发者可以利用Lua脚本自定义编辑器的各种功能,从而满足个性化需求。,,该编辑器还内置了LSP(Language Server Protocol)功能,为开发者提供了实时的语法高亮、智能代码补全、实时错误检查等强大功能。LSP技术使得编辑器能够更好地理解代码,提供智能化的提示和建议,极大地提高了开发效率和代码质量。,,这款下一代终极编辑器不仅具备强大的功能,还注重用户体验。编辑器界面简洁明了,操作便捷,即使是新手也能轻松上手。编辑器还支持多种编程语言的开发,满足不同项目的需求。,,下一代终极编辑器是一款功能强大、易于使用的编程工具。其Lua驱动和内置LSP功能为开发者带来了更加顺畅、高效的编码体验。无论是初学者还是资深开发者,都能在这款编辑器中找到满足自己需求的解决方案。

写代码这么多年,经常被这些事情困扰:
服务器上改个配置文件要开VSCode,太重了;vim又显得原始,连个智能提示都没有。写代码时要在终端和编辑器间反复横跳。项目大了以后IDE越来越卡,风扇狂转。https://post.smzdm.com/p/ardek5zw/

这些问题一直存在,直到遇见了Neovim。https://post.smzdm.com/p/ardek5zw/

https://post.smzdm.com/p/ardek5zw/

https://post.smzdm.com/p/ardek5zw/

Neovim能做什么

现代化编辑体验

  • • 内置LSP支持,不依赖第三方插件就能实现代码补全https://post.smzdm.com/p/ardek5zw/

  • • 异步任务处理,大文件不卡顿https://post.smzdm.com/p/ardek5zw/

  • • 内置终端,告别反复切换窗口https://post.smzdm.com/p/ardek5zw/

  • • 支持多种现代GUI,也能纯终端使用https://post.smzdm.com/p/ardek5zw/

强大的扩展能力

  • • 用Lua写插件和配置,比Vimscript更容易https://post.smzdm.com/p/ardek5zw/

  • • 支持Python、Node.js等语言扩展https://post.smzdm.com/p/ardek5zw/

  • • 兼容95%以上的Vim插件https://post.smzdm.com/p/ardek5zw/

  • • 插件生态丰富,想要的功能基本都有https://post.smzdm.com/p/ardek5zw/

性能和稳定性

  • • 启动速度快,内存占用低https://post.smzdm.com/p/ardek5zw/

  • • 完全异步设计,操作不卡顿https://post.smzdm.com/p/ardek5zw/

  • • 代码经过重构,更容易维护https://post.smzdm.com/p/ardek5zw/

  • • 社区活跃,问题修复快https://post.smzdm.com/p/ardek5zw/

项目效果预览

各种插件https://post.smzdm.com/p/ardek5zw/

markdown-preview.nvim:支持浏览器中通过同步滚动预览Markdown文件https://post.smzdm.com/p/ardek5zw/

转载请注明来自和福秀元自媒体网,本文标题:《下一代Lua驱动终极编辑器,内置LSP,编码丝滑体验》

百度分享代码,如果开启HTTPS请参考李洋个人博客
每一天,每一秒,你所做的决定都会改变你的人生!
Top